Circuit/System Description

The left and right rear passenger heated seats are controlled by separate heated seat switches. The switches are located on the rear door panels. When a heated seat switch is pressed, ground is momentarily applied through the switch contacts and the switch signal circuit to the rear heated seat module. In response to this signal, the module then applies battery voltage through the element supply voltage circuits to the seat cushion and seat back heating elements. The heated seat module then supplies a ground through the appropriate indicator control circuits to the heated seat switch illuminating the switch indicators.

Circuit/System Verification

1. Ignition ON, use a scan tool to observe the Rear Heated Seat Module Rear Seat HVC Mode parameter while pressing the heated seat back and cushion switch. The reading should change between Off and Back and Cushion.

If not Back and Cushion, perform the Circuit/System Testing.

2. While observing the Rear Seat HVC Mode parameter, press the heated seat back only mode switch. The reading should change between Back and Cushion and Back Only.

If not Back Only, perform the Circuit/System Testing.

3. If both Rear Seat HVC Mode parameters displayed correctly and there are no DTCs set, replace the heated seat module.



Circuit/System Testing

1. Ignition OFF, disconnect the harness connector at the heated seat switch.
2. Test for less than 5 ohms of resistance between the heated seat switch ground circuit terminal J and ground.

If greater than 5 ohms, repair the ground circuit for an open/high resistance.

3. Ignition ON, use a scan tool to observe the Rear Heated Seat Module Rear Seat HVC Mode parameter. The reading should be Off.

If not Off, test the appropriate signal circuit for a short to ground. If the circuit tests normal, replace the heated seat module.

4. Install a 3A fused jumper wire between the switch signal circuit terminal G and ground. Verify the Rear Seat HVC Mode parameter is Back and Cushion.

If not Back and Cushion, test the signal circuit for a short to voltage or an open/high resistance. If the circuit tests normal, replace the heated seat module.

5. Install a 3A fused jumper wire between the switch signal circuit terminal A and ground. Verify the Rear Seat HVC Mode parameter is Back Only.

If not Back Only, test the signal circuit for a short to voltage or an open/high resistance. If the circuit tests normal, replace the heated seat module.

6. If all circuits tests normal, test or replace the heated seat switch.



Component Testing


Rear Heated Seat Switch
1. Ignition OFF, disconnect the harness connector at the heated seat switch switch.
2. Test for infinite resistance between the signal terminal G and the ground terminal J with the back and cushion switch in the open position.

If less than infinite, replace the heated seat switch switch.

3. Test for infinite resistance between the signal terminal A and the ground terminal J with the back only switch in the open position.

If less than infinite, replace the heated seat switch switch.

4. Test for less than 5 ohms between the signal terminal G and the ground terminal J with the back and cushion switch in the closed position.

If greater than 5 ohms, replace the heated seat switch.

5. Test for less than 5 ohms between the signal terminal A and the ground terminal J with the back only switch in the closed position.

If greater than 5 ohms, replace the heated seat switch.

6. Connect a 3A fused jumper wire between the heated seat switch supply voltage terminal K and battery voltage.
7. Connect a test lamp between the following indicator control circuits and ground. The selected indicator should illuminate.

* Terminal B seat back only mode indicator
* Terminal C low heat indicator
* Terminal D medium heat indicator
* Terminal E high heat indicator
* Terminal H seat back cushion mode indicator

If any of the indicators do not illuminate, replace the rear heated seat switch.
